Job description
Location - The position is a Hybrid working Senior Network Engineering role with minimum 2 days site-based in one of the DXC reginal delivery centres in Glasgow or Newcastle. Expectation is the successful candidate will cover project delivery on UK Secure accounts., We are seeking a skilled Firewall Engineer to design, implement, manage, and troubleshoot firewall solutions in a large multi-vendor/multi-site environment for a DXC Customer. The ideal candidate will have in-depth knowledge of firewall technologies, network security principles, and best practices to ensure robust defence against cyber threats. The role focus will cover Firewall and Security infrastructures, with a key focus on Palo Alto, Cisco, Juniper and Tufin product portfolios. Expectation is the successful candidate will have proven work experience in a challenging, multi-vendor environment working as part of a team delivering both project engineering and support functions., * Design, deploy, configure, and maintain firewall infrastructure (e.g., Palo Alto, Cisco, Juniper).
- Monitor firewall performance and analyse security logs to detect and respond to security incidents.
- Implement firewall rules, policies, and access control lists (ACLs) based on organizational security requirements.
- Collaborate with network, security, and IT teams to ensure seamless integration of firewall systems.
- Conduct firewall rule reviews, audits, and compliance checks regularly.
- Troubleshoot and resolve firewall-related issues promptly to minimize downtime.
- Stay updated with the latest security threats and firewall technologies to recommend improvements.
- Document firewall configurations, changes, and procedures for audit and knowledge sharing.
- Participate in incident response and disaster recovery planning related to firewall infrastructure.
